Redevelopment Update

Late yesterday (Friday 16th May 2025), Swindon Town Football Club made a formal request to The County Ground Stadium Custodians Limited (the Joint Venture company) for landlord consent to redevelop the Nigel Eady County Ground.
 

The Club are seeking consent to add new hospitality facilities, executive boxes and extended facilities to the Don Rogers Stand. An initial review suggests that no changes have been made to the plans and concepts proposed by the Club as part of the consultation period launched on 14th April 2025.
 

Under the terms of the Joint Venture Agreement, landlord consent requests require the unanimous approval of both JV shareholders (the Club and the Trust). Therefore, the Joint Venture Board will now seek approval from both organisations.

The County Ground Swindon

From a Trust perspective, the Trust Board will now review the consent request before confirming a timeline of next steps to members.
 

Over the next two weeks, we understand that the Club will address outstanding redevelopment questions and share with supporters further information in response to concerns raised through the consultation process.

Any Trust membership vote will not take place before 1st June 2025 but for any vote which takes place in the first two weeks of June, the cutoff date for new members will be 5pm on 21st May 2025 (this is to ensure that the Direct Debit is set up and the membership fee of new members will have been paid ahead of being issued a vote).


In order to secure your vote in any future redevelopment of the Nigel Eady County Ground you will need to have paid into TrustSTFC prior to the vote taking place.
